Description

A kind of industrial production citrate minerals grind grading device
Technical field
The utility model relates to mechanical equipment technical field, specially a kind of industrial production citrate minerals ore grinding Grading plant.
Background technique
It is a highly important process that mineral aggregate is milled in process, therefore milling device uses in mineral aggregate processing More frequently.
A kind of grind grading device disclosed in Chinese utility model patent ublic specification of application CN207013100U, A kind of grind grading device, which can be milled to mineral aggregate and second level screening, can effectively realize the essence of mineral aggregate Processing, head of milling are hemispherical dome structure, which can play the role of mineral aggregate effectively to mill, and vibration frame includes vibration master Bar, strut, vibrating spring and installation bolt, vibration mobile jib are arranged on bobbing machine, and strut is symmetricly set on the two of vibration mobile jib End, vibrating spring are arranged on strut, and vibrating spring is fixed on screening cabinet by installing bolt, which can rise It is acted on to conduct vibrations.
Currently, a kind of existing grind grading device screening is not thorough enough, will cause screening, qualified minerals are caused It is lost, cannot mill and sieve again for sieving underproof minerals, cause the use of mineral flux.

The utility model provides a kind of technical solution referring to FIG. 1-2: a kind of industrial production citrate minerals mill Mine grading plant, including grader 1 offer cavity 2 inside one end of grader 1, and 2 upper end inner sidewall of cavity is fixedly connected with electricity One end of machine 3, the other end middle part of motor 3 are flexibly connected one end of main shaft 4, and the other end of main shaft 4 is fixedly connected with first gear The lower end outside at 5 middle part, first gear 5 is flexibly connected on the outside of the upper end of second gear 6, and the middle part activity of second gear 6 connects One end of fixed link 7 is connect, the other end of fixed link 7 is fixedly connected with the lower inner side wall of cavity 2, outside the middle-end of second gear 6 Side is flexibly connected on the outside of one end of third gear 8, and the middle part of third gear 8 is fixedly connected with the inner wall of cavity 2 by pin shaft, passed through Motor 3 drive third gear 8 rotate, third gear 8 rotate outer surface be teeth be it is trapezoidal, prevent that adjustable shelf 9 is caused to damage Wound, makes the more convenient to use of third gear 8;
One end of adjustable shelf 9 is flexibly connected on the outside of the other end of third gear 8, the other end of adjustable shelf 9 is fixedly connected with essence In the middle part of one end of dusting cover subnetting 10, the vibration of fine Screening Network 10 is driven by the rotation of third gear 8, passes through fine Screening Network 10 vibration can perfectly sieve minerals, can prevent the omission of minerals, increase the effect of screening, fine to sieve Side wall of the other end of net 10 through cavity 2 and the inside positioned at grader 1, the other end and grader 1 of fine Screening Network 10 Inner wall be flexibly connected, fine 10 both ends outer surface of Screening Network is fixedly connected to vibrationproof cotton 11, fine 10 surface of Screening Network Vibrationproof cotton 11 can prevent fine Screening Network 10 from causing to damage when vibrosieve, protect fine Screening Network 10, increase The service life of fine Screening Network 10, the inner sidewall of cavity 2 are fixedly connected with one end of restriction plate 12, fine Screening Network 10 One end of spring 13 is fixedly connected at the top of one end, the spring 13 at fine 10 top of Screening Network can increase fine Screening Network 10 Vibrating effect, the other end of spring 13 and the bottom of restriction plate 12, the lower inner side wall of cavity 2 are fixedly connected with L shape position-limited rack 14 One end, L shape position-limited rack 14 can prevent the movement of fine Screening Network 10, and the other end side of L shape position-limited rack 14 offers circle Slot, the internal activity of circular groove are connected with ball 15, and the outside of ball 15 is flexibly connected with one end of fine Screening Network 10, ball 15 The vibration that fine Screening Network 10 can be increased can prevent influence of the L shape position-limited rack 14 to fine Screening Network 10.
A kind of optimal technical scheme as the utility model: the top middle portion of grader 1 connects by the way that conveyance conduit is fixed Pulverizer 16 is connect, conveyance conduit is in funnel shaped, and the minerals after facilitating pulverizer 16 crushed enter grader 1 and sieved Point.
A kind of optimal technical scheme as the utility model: the inner wall of pulverizer 16 is fixedly connected with the both ends of baffle, prevents Only minerals enter driving motor, ring to the operation radiography of driving motor, the inner sidewall of pulverizer 16 is fixedly connected with driving motor One end, the other end of driving motor is connected with helical axis 17, drives helical-blade rotation, the outer surface of helical axis 17 is fixed Multiple helical-blades are connected with, minerals are crushed by the rotation of helical-blade, grader 1 is facilitated to be screened.
A kind of optimal technical scheme as the utility model: the top of pulverizer 16 is fixedly connected with pan feeding pipeline, enters It is fixedly connected with funnel at the top of pipe material, minerals is facilitated to enter the inside of pulverizer 16.
A kind of optimal technical scheme as the utility model: the side of grader 1 is fixedly connected with discharging bin 18, discharging The bottom in storehouse 18 is fixedly connected with discharge bucket, can be convenient the storage of the minerals screened out to fine Screening Network 10, prevents pair The minerals screened out cause to be lost.
A kind of optimal technical scheme as the utility model: the other side of grader 1 is fixedly connected with returning charge storehouse 19, can To store not by the minerals of fine Screening Network 10, the top in returning charge storehouse 19 is fixedly connected with the one of charging absorption pump 20 by transport pipeline The other side of side, charging absorption pump 20 is fixedly connected by transport pipeline with pulverizer 16, and the minerals inside returning charge storehouse 19 can be made The inside for coming back to pulverizer 16, is crushed again and is sieved.
